The Mechanics of Savory Sensations: 5 Simple Steps To Wrapping Perfection
Step 1: Choose the Perfect Cut of Steak
Selecting the right steak is crucial for a successful bacon-wrapped dish. Look for tender cuts with good marbling, such as ribeye or filet mignon. Avoid thin or lean cuts, as they may not hold up to the cooking process.
When selecting your steak, consider the level of doneness you prefer. For a tender, pink center, aim for a medium-rare to medium temperature. Be sure to let your steak come to room temperature before cooking to ensure even cooking.
Step 2: Prepare the Bacon
Crisp, smoky bacon is the key to a successful bacon-wrapped steak. Choose thick-cut bacon for the best results, as it will hold its shape and provide a satisfying crunch.
When cooking the bacon, aim for a crispy texture rather than a chewy one. This will help the bacon adhere to the steak during cooking, creating a cohesive, savory flavor experience.
Step 3: Wrap the Steak in Bacon
When wrapping the steak in bacon, aim for an even, uniform layer. This will help the bacon cook evenly and prevent any bare spots on the steak.
Use kitchen twine or toothpicks to secure the bacon in place, if necessary. This will ensure the bacon stays put during cooking and prevents it from unwrapping or falling off during serving.
Step 4: Cook the Bacon-Wrapped Steak
Cooking the bacon-wrapped steak requires patience and attention to temperature. Preheat your grill or oven to the desired temperature, and cook the steak to the desired level of doneness.
Use a meat thermometer to ensure the steak reaches a safe internal temperature. For medium-rare, aim for an internal temperature of 130-135°F. For medium, aim for 140-145°F.
Step 5: Let it Rest
After cooking the bacon-wrapped steak, let it rest for 5-10 minutes before slicing. This allows the juices to redistribute and the steak to retain its tenderness.
